AEW DYNAMITE TV REPORT
FEBRUARY 26, 2020
KANSAS CITY, KS. AT SILVERSTEIN EYE CENTER ARENA
AIRED LIVE ON TNT

Announcers: Jim Ross, Tony Schiavone, Excalibur

Ring Announcer: Justin Roberts

[HOUR ONE]

-They went right to the arena as pyro blasted and Ross introduced the show, noting it’s the last stop on the road to AEW Revolution on Saturday night. They went to the announcing trio on camera who hyped Best Friends (w/Orange Cassidy) vs. The Butcher & The Blade (w/Bunny), Yuka Sakazaki vs. Big Swole vs. Shanna vs. Hikiaru Shida, Sammy Guevara & Santana & Ortiz vs. Jurassic Express, and Kenny Omega vs. Pac in the 30 minute Iron Man match. Also, a weigh-in for the Chris Jericho vs. Jon Moxley match.

(1) PAC vs. KENNY OMEGA (w/The Young Bucks) – 30 minute Iron Man match

The announcers talked about how Pac had been in training for weeks focused on just this match, while Omega has been active but in tag matches only. Omega landed a running flip dive over the top rope onto Pac at ringside at 3:00. Kenny stayed on office for a few more minutes. Pac rolled to the floor to catch his breath. Fans booed. Kenny went after him, but Pac caught him with some punches to take over. He landed a tornado DDT on the floor at 6:00. Ross said that could be the difference-making moment of the match. Pac landed a top rope brainbuster suplex at 7:30. Fans chanted “Holy shit!” The pace kept up with big spots and near falls.

They stood mid-ring at 12:00 and exchanges blows. The crowd cheered with each blow. Omega landed a Tiger Driver ’98 for a believable near fall. Omega set up a One-Winged Angel, but Pac escaped. Omega turned it into a back suplex into a bridge for another believable near fall. Fans loudly chanted “AEW! AEW!” Omega lifted Pac onto his shoulders and climbed to the top rope, but Pac spun around and landed a powerbomb off the top rope. Pac then mounted Omega in another corner, but Omega dropped Pac face-first over the top turnbuckle and then followed up with a Snap Dragon Suplex and a V-Trigger for a very near fall.

Pac recovered magically quickly at ringside and began searching for something under the ring. Then he jabbed Omega in the head with the chair. The ref DQ’d him. The Young Bucks protested and jumped onto the ring apron. The ref turned to them, which gave Pac an opening to hit Omega in the back of his head with the chair. The Bucks entered and checked on Omega. Excalibur noted the clock was stopped for 30 seconds before the match restarted. Nick Jackson splashed water on Omega’s face.

FIRST FALL: Omega via DQ in 15;54.

Pac landed a Black Arrow off the top rope to get the fall back.

SECOND FALL: Pac at 16:39. [c]

They stayed with the action on split screen during a commercial which included a plug for the AEW Revolution PPV event. Back from the break, Pac sitout powerbombed Omega off the ring apron. Fans loudly chanted “Holy shit!” TNT muted the sound. Both were slow to get up. Pac dropkicked Omega off the ring apron and Omega landed on the referee Paul Turner. Pac smiled and pulled a table out from under the ring. Ross said he’s been disqualified once already. Excalibur said that first DQ was strategic. Excalibur said that’s the first DQ they’ve had in AEW. (Wow.) Fans chanted “We want tables!” The AEW doctor checked on Omega. Ross said he could stop the match if Omega can’t defend himself. Pac put Omega on the table. Ross wondered if another referee would be to the ring soon. Pac elbowed Omega’s throat and then leaped off the top rope with a shooting star press through the table. Both were down and slow to get up. They cut to fans in the crowd reacting with gasps.

The Bucks and the doctor checked on the wrestlers on the floor. He started to countout both wrestlers. Ross wondered what happened if there was a double countout. Pac reentered the ring. Matt threw Omega into the ring to just beat the count. Ross said that was a judgement call by the referee. Pac went for a Black Arrow, but Omega lifted his knees at 25;00. Both again were slow to get up. Omega then delivered a V-Trigger to Pac’s jaw. Then a second to the side of Pac’s head. He scored a two count after a Uranage.

Omega charged at Pac with a knee, then lifted him onto his shoulders, but Pac revered a Snap Dragon attempt. Omega sold being out on his knees. He stood, but Pac gave him a swinging DDT. Pac locked on his Brutalizer submission with under three minutes left. Fans chanted “Kenny! Kenny!” Omega grabbed the bottom rope a minute later to force a break. Pac went right back to the Brutalizer. Schiavone called it great strategy. Fans chanted “Kenny! Kenny!” Omega leveraged Pac’s shoulders down for a soft two count before Pac leveraged Omega back into the Brutalizer with 45 seconds left. Omega struggled to break free as the clock counted down to zero. So they went 30 minutes with a 1-1 score.
